Luhrin e light of our lives, Bronwyn Clare Anderson Pipitone, went out the morning of July 1, 2016 when she was taken from us by a cardiac arrest. Her parents, Lee G. and Sheila Bobbs Anderson rst saw her bright light in Wilmington on May 6, 1975. Bronwyn graduated from St. Marks in 1993 and from Widener University with a degree in Hospitality Management in 1997. She went on to become a Shore Excursion Manager for Holland America Line where she met the Matador of Magic, Joe (Devlin) Pipitone, the love of her life. ey were married at home in the garden in 2003, an event that was lmed and shown on the Wedding Channel, much to the couple’s delight. Bronwyn was a spirited, creative, intelligent, beautiful, and fun loving woman who was devoted to and beloved by her family. A self proclaimed ‘uber planner,’ she was also a party planner par excellence. Bronwyn was an avid reader and movie fan. She appreciated ‘bling’ in most any form and enjoyed ‘planking’ wherever she could. She and the Matador performed their Magic on land and cruise ships delighting audiences of all ages all over the world. Bronwyn is survived by her parents, her brother Pearce, her aunt, Pamela Bobbs, her beloved husband Joe and her precious Brooklyn family, Pierina, Angie, George, Julia and Joey.
